6th May: Essentials of Music Management

Essentials of Music Management is an in person course aiming to provide an introductory and key overview of the skills it takes to be a professional music manager.
 
Although the role of a manager takes many forms depending on clients needs, there are essential aspects all managers should be aware of including how to build a team, the role of PRS, PPL, and the role of key partners such as lawyers, accountants and insurance brokers.
 
This course is built around the MMF Code of Practice as well as the first chapters within our Essentials of Music Management book. The day will cover how to develop your act so it is market ready and importantly how managers build their business. Led by Martin Tibbetts, an artist manager and educator with extensive live music experience, along with professional guests this essential course will cover key questions for early career managers, those wishing to enter the profession and those who wish to brush up on the most recent changes in the role.
